Default Veterans Day 2022

Happy Veterans day to all my fellow countrymen who once wore the uniform of our nation.

We have a bit of a different slant to 11/11 than our British and Commonwealth Friends. To us it is the day that we appreciate those who have served their country honorably. A day for old men to pin on a medal or wear an old cap and be thanked for their service by a grateful public. Unlike Armistice Day it is not supposed to be a somber remembrance of the dead but rather a celebration of the living.

Our day for (what should be solemn) remembrance is Memorial Day where we pay homage to those who gave their lives in service to our country.

There is also a third holiday called Armed Forces Day (although nobody gets it off, including the Armed Forces), which is for those who are currently serving in the military.
